What building in Southern River actually involves
23 endorsed structure plans cover Southern River, planned for about 4,101 dwellings in 13.21 km². That is the densest concentration of separately-planned land of any suburb published on this site.
Twenty-three plans is twenty-three sets of rules
In a structure-plan area the lot layout, density and staging are fixed before any block reaches the market, so the plan — not the scheme map — decides what you can build. With this many of them in one suburb, a builder's experience under one plan does not transfer to the next, and "I've built in Southern River" is not the reassurance it sounds like. Ask which plan, and read it.
Staging decides when, not just what
A yield of about 4,101 dwellings is not delivered at once. The stage your block sits in determines when roads, power, water and sewer actually arrive, which on growth-front land is the difference between building next year and building in five.
R20 to R80
Four codes across a fourfold density range. The code sets the minimum and average lot size, the setbacks and the open space requirement.
Industrial and service commercial land alongside
An Industrial development zone and service commercial land are mapped within the suburb. Neither is residential and you cannot build a house on either — which is exactly why they matter: they govern what can happen next door.
What to ask a builder
Ask which structure plan covers the lot, which stage it is in, and when services are scheduled. Ask what sits on the land immediately adjoining.
